JTAG Cable Connection
Use a JTAG cable (sold separately) to connect the evaluation board to your PC:
1. Connect external +5 V and GND power to pad locations J5 and J6 (Schematic Sheet 5 of 6).
2. Connect a JTAG cable from a JTAG source to the board's JTAG header (J3) (Schematic Sheet 5 of 6) on the
right side of the board.

Run the Processor Support Demo
The POWR607 Processor Support Demo illustrates key functions of the POWR607: voltage supervisor, reset gen-
erator, and watchdog timer (WDT). The block diagram of the processor support demo, Figure 3, shows the
POWR607 interface to a simulated processor/DSP. LEDs and switches are used to emulate the processor inter-
face.
Many processor power management scenarios can be shown with the POWR607 evaluation board. Follow the pro-
cedure below to emulate one particular case.
1. Set the POWR607 configuration to indicate 1.8 V Supply OK, disable reset pulse stretch and enable a two- sec-
ond watchdog timer period. 
Select DIP Switch (1, 2, 3, 4) = 0010
Note: To indicate a logical 1, slide the switch towards the 1, 2, 3, or 4 numeral marks on the case. Select the
R16 Slider = 3.3 V position.
2. Press and then release the Reset push button. 
The POWR607 Evaluation Board is reset. The CPU Reset LED (D2) lights to indicate the reset condition. The
WDT timer is reset and the two-second WDT count begins.
3. Press and release the WD_Trig push button.
The WDT_Trig signal is asserted by the processor/DSP. The POWR607 timer/counter is reset and the two- sec-
ond watchdog timer restarts.
Continue pressing the WD_Trig to "pet" the watchdog timer to prevent the two-second timeout.
4. Wait for two seconds and allow the WDT timer period to expire.
The POWR607 asserts the WDT_Intr output signal and the WDT_Interrupt LED (D11) lights momentarily to
indicate the interrupt condition.
In the next step you will increase the watchdog timer period from 2 seconds to 10 seconds and enable Reset
Pulse Stretch.
5. Select SW1 (1, 2, 3, 4) = 0101. Also select the R16 Slider = 3.3 V position. Press and release the Reset push
button on the POWR607 board.
The CPU Reset LED (D2) light indicates the reset condition. The WDT timer is reset and the 10-second WDT
count begins.
